hu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]Nginx配置自动化,提升运维效率的利器|nginx 自动启动,Nginx配置自动化,Nginx配置自动化,解锁高效运维的秘密武器

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文介绍了如何利用Nginx配置自动化技术,实现Nginx自动启动,以提升Linux操作系统运维效率。通过自动化配置,可减少人工干预,降低错误率,提高运维工作的效率和稳定性。

本文目录导读:

  1. Nginx配置自动化的意义
  2. Nginx配置自动化的实现方法
  3. Nginx配置自动化的优势

随着互联网技术的快速发展,网站和应用系统的复杂性日益增加,运维人员面临着巨大的挑战,在这种情况下,Nginx配置自动化成为了一种提高运维效率、降低人工干预的重要手段,本文将介绍Nginx配置自动化的意义、实现方法及其优势。

Nginx配置自动化的意义

1、提高运维效率:通过自动化工具,可以快速完成Nginx配置的部署和调整,节省了大量的人力和时间成本。

2、降低人工错误:自动化配置减少了人工干预,降低了因操作失误导致的配置错误。

3、灵活应对业务变化:自动化配置可以快速适应业务需求的变化,为业务发展提供有力支持。

4、提升系统稳定性:自动化配置可以确保Nginx配置的一致性和正确性,从而提高系统的稳定性。

Nginx配置自动化的实现方法

1、使用配置管理工具:如Ansible、Puppet、Chef等,这些工具可以自动部署和调整Nginx配置文件。

2、编写自定义脚本:使用Python、Shell等脚本语言编写自动化脚本,实现Nginx配置的自动化。

3、利用Nginx配置管理模块:如Nginx Configurator、Nginx Helper等,这些模块可以帮助运维人员自动化地管理Nginx配置。

以下以Ansible为例,介绍如何实现Nginx配置自动化。

1、安装Ansible:在控制节点上安装Ansible。

pip install ansible

2、编写Ansible playbook:创建一个Ansible playbook,用于部署Nginx配置。

- name: Deploy Nginx configuration
  hosts: nginx_servers
  become: yes
  tasks:
    - name: Install Nginx
      apt:
        name: nginx
        state: present
    - name: Copy Nginx configuration file
      copy:
        src: /path/to/nginx.conf
        dest: /etc/nginx/nginx.conf
    - name: Restart Nginx
      service:
        name: nginx
        state: restarted

3、运行Ansible playbook:在控制节点上运行以下命令,执行playbook。

ansible-playbook deploy_nginx.yml

Nginx配置自动化的优势

1、提高运维效率:自动化配置可以快速完成Nginx部署和调整,节省了大量的人力和时间成本。

2、降低人工错误:自动化配置减少了人工干预,降低了因操作失误导致的配置错误。

3、灵活应对业务变化:自动化配置可以快速适应业务需求的变化,为业务发展提供有力支持。

4、提升系统稳定性:自动化配置确保了Nginx配置的一致性和正确性,从而提高了系统的稳定性。

5、便于监控和排错:自动化配置生成的日志文件可以方便地监控Nginx的运行状态,便于排错和优化。

Nginx配置自动化是提高运维效率、降低人工干预的重要手段,通过使用配置管理工具、编写自定义脚本或利用Nginx配置管理模块,可以实现Nginx配置的自动化,自动化配置不仅提高了运维效率,降低了人工错误,还提升了系统的稳定性和可靠性。

以下为50个中文相关关键词:

Nginx配置自动化,运维效率,Ansible,Puppet,Chef,配置管理工具,自定义脚本,配置管理模块,自动化部署,自动化调整,业务变化,系统稳定性,人工干预,运维成本,监控,排错,优化,运维人员,Python,Shell,Ansible playbook,安装Ansible,部署Nginx,配置文件,重启Nginx,降低错误率,业务发展,日志文件,运维自动化,系统可靠性,运维管理,自动化运维,运维优化,运维工具,自动化脚本,自动化配置,运维效率提升,运维排错,运维监控,运维优化策略,运维自动化工具,运维自动化技术,运维自动化平台,运维自动化系统,运维自动化解决方案,运维自动化实施,运维自动化效果,运维自动化优势,运维自动化前景,运维自动化趋势。

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

Nginx配置自动化:nginx 自定义模块

高效运维:高效运维社区核心成员

原文链接:,转发请注明来源!